@charset "utf-8";
/* CSS Document */

body {
	font-family:Arial, Helvetica, sans-serif;
	font-size:.83em;
	background:url(images/bg.jpg) repeat-x;
	margin-top:0px;
}

#center {
	width:850px;
	margin-left:auto;
	margin-right:auto;
}

#header{
	position:relative;
	width:850px;
	height:128px;
}

#logo {
	width:546px;
	height:128px;
	float:left;
	position:absolute;
}

#help {
	position:absolute;
	margin:6px 0px 0px 622px;
	color:#67ba91;
	float:left;
}

#phone {
	color:#67ba91;
	width:199px;
	height:27px;
	margin:20px 0px 0px 600px;
	position:absolute;
	float:left;
	text-align:center;
	font-size:20px;
	font-weight:bolder;
}

#nav {
	padding-top:6px;
	text-align:center;
	color:#FFF;
	height:24px;
}

#nav >a:link, #nav >a:visited{
	text-decoration:none;
	color:#FFF;
	padding-right:20px;
	padding-left:20px;
}

#nav >a:hover {
	text-decoration:none;
	color:#666;
}

#new {
	background:url(images/newBox2.png) no-repeat;
	width:189px;
	height:300px;
	position:absolute;
	margin-left:636px;
}

#submit {
	position:absolute;
	width:84px;
	height:27px;
	margin:251px 0px 0px 54px;
}

#newinput 
{
	position:absolute;
	width:180px;
	height:190px;
	margin:75px 0px 0px 5px;
	float:left;
	color:#FFF;	
}

/*--index--*/

#return {
	background:url(images/returnBox.jpg) no-repeat;
	width:326px;
	height:84px;
	float:left;
	margin:45px 0px 0px 525px;
	position:absolute;
}

#returninput 
{
	text-decoration:none;
    color:#FFF;
	width:250px;
	height:63px;
	margin:23px 0px 0px 5px;
	position:absolute;
	float:left;
}

#enter {
	width:67px;
	height:21px;
	margin:45px 0px 0px 235px;
	position:absolute;
}

#navBar {
	background:url(images/navBar.jpg) no-repeat;
	width:850px;
	height:30px;
	position:relative;
}

#main {
	background:url(images/mainPic.jpg) no-repeat;
	width:850px;
	height:283px;
	position:relative;
}

#upTo {
	position:absolute;
	float:left;
	margin:20px 0px 0px 265px;
	color:#67ba91;
	line-height:20px;
}

#apply {
    text-decoration:none;
    position:absolute;
    float:left;
    color:#67ba91;
    margin:156px 0px 0px 398px;
}

/*#apply >a:link, #apply >a:visited{
	text-decoration:none;
	color:#67ba91;
}*/

#apply >a:hover {
	text-decoration:none;
	color:#666;
}

.size {
	font-size:1.5em;
	margin-bottom:0px;
	margin-top:0px;
}

#boxes {
	position:relative;
	margin-top:16px;
	height:340px;
}

#fast {
	background:url(images/fast.jpg) no-repeat;
	width:255px;
	height:319px;
	float:left;
	margin-left:18px;
	position:relative;
}

li {
	line-height:20px;
	font-weight:bold;
}

#fastList {
	width:220px;
	margin:76px 0px 0px 3px;
	position:absolute;
	color:#FFF;
}

#easy {
	background:url(images/easy.jpg) no-repeat;
	width:254px;
	height:319px;
	float:left;
	margin-left:23px;
	position:relative;
}

#easyList {
	width:200px;
	margin:82px 0px 0px 34px;
	position:absolute;
	color:#FFF;
}

#secure {
	background:url(images/secure.jpg) no-repeat;
	width:254px;
	height:319px;
	float:left;
	margin-left:23px;
	position:relative;
}

#secureList {
	width:190px;
	margin:80px 0px 0px 22px;
	position:absolute;
	color:#FFF;
}

/*--- Secure ---*/

#secureMain {
	background:url(images/securePic.jpg) no-repeat;
	width:850px;
	height:285px;
	position:relative;
}

#navBar2 {
	background:url(images/navBar2.jpg) no-repeat;
	width:850px;
	height:30px;
	position:relative;
}

#privacy {
	float:left;
	position:absolute;
	color:#67ba91;
	margin:50px 0px 0px 408px;
}

#privacy2 {
	width:200px;
	float:left;
	position:absolute;
	color:#67ba91;
	margin:90px 0px 0px 405px;
	text-align:center;
}

#secureContainer {
	position:relative;
	margin-top:30px;
	height:400px;
}

.siteSecurity {
	font-size:1.5em;
	margin-bottom:0px;
	margin-top:0px;
	text-align:center;
}

#secureInfo {
	float:left;
	width:300px;
	color:#67ba91;
	margin:33px 0px 0px 45px;
	position:relative;
	line-height:20px;
}

#secureInfo2 {
	position:relative;
	float:left;
	width:340px;
	padding-right:35px;
	color:#67ba91;
	margin:30px 0px 0px 55px;
	border-right:#67ba91 thin solid;
}

.privPol {
	font-weight:100;
}

#confident {
	float:left;
	color:#67ba91;
	margin:30px 0px 0px 125px;
	width:600px;
	text-align:center;
	position:relative;
}

/*--- How it Works ---*/
#easyAs {
    position:absolute;
    width:265px;
    color:#67ba91;
    text-align:right;
    margin:65px 0px 0px 317px;
}

#howContent {
    height:779px;
    position:relative;
}

#fill {
    position:absolute;
    width:200px;
    margin:58px 0px 0px 70px;
    color:#67ba91;
}

#fill a:link, #fill a:visited {
    text-decoration:none;
    color:#67ba91;
}

#fill a:hover {
    text-decoration:none;
    color:#333333;
}

#approved {
    position:absolute;
    margin:53px 0px 0px 320px;
    color:#67ba91;
    width:200px;
}

#cash {
    position:absolute;
    margin:69px 0px 0px 570px;
    color:#67ba91;
    width:200px;
}

#howItWorks{
    position:absolute;
    width:365px;
    margin:320px 0px 0px 50px;
}

#howItWorks2{
    position:absolute;
    width:346px;
    margin:320px 0px 0px 444px;
}

#basicaly {
    position:absolute;
    width:250px;
    text-align:center;
    margin:617px 0px 0px 121px;

}

#requirements {
    position:absolute;
    width:250px;
    margin:581px 0px 0px 492px;

}

#resource {
    position:absolute;
    text-align:center;
    width:300px;
    margin:695px 0px 0px 101px;
}

#resource a:link, #resource a:visited {
    text-decoration:none;
    color:#67ba91;
}

#resource a:hover {
    text-decoration:none;
    color:#000;
}

#howMain {
	background:url(images/howPic.jpg) no-repeat;
	width:850px;
	height:285px;
	position:relative;
}

#navBar3 {
	background:url(images/navBar3.jpg) no-repeat;
	width:850px;
	height:30px;
	position:relative;
}

/*--- Contact ---*/

#contactMain {
	background:url(images/contactPic.jpg) no-repeat;
	width:850px;
	height:285px;
}

#contactContent{
	height:300px;
}

#contactInfo {
    position:absolute;
    float:left;
    width:195px;
    color:#67ba91;
    margin:80px 0px 0px 420px;
    text-align:right;
}

/*--- Results --*/

#resultsContent 
{
	text-align:center;
	height:300px;
	color:#67ba91;
}

#navBarR {
	width:850px;
	height:30px;
	position:relative;
}

/*--- FAQ's ---*/

#faqMain {
	background:url(images/faqPic.jpg) no-repeat;
	width:850px;
	height:300px;
}

#navBar4 {
	background:url(images/navBar4.jpg) no-repeat;
	width:850px;
	height:30px;
	position:relative;
}

#faq {
	color:#67ba91;
	width:200px;
	float:left;
	text-align:center;
	margin:40px 0px 0px 40px;
	position:absolute;
}

#questions {
	color:#67ba91;
	width:220px;
	float:left;
	text-align:center;
	position:absolute;
	margin:140px 0px 0px 30px;
}

#faqContent {
	/*height:3000px;*/
}

/*----- Resources ----*/

#content {
	width:600px;
	margin:0px 0px 0px 135px;
}

.resource {
	color:#67ba91;
	margin:20px 0px 10px 244px;
	font-size:1.5em;
}

#click, #click2, #click3, #click4, #click5, #click6, #click7, #click8, #click9, #click10, #click11{
	color:#FFF;
	background:url(images/button.jpg) no-repeat;
	width:254px;
	height:24px;
	padding:6px 0px 8px 0px;
	cursor:pointer;
	text-align:center;
	margin-left:166px;
}

#content a:link {
	color:#67ba91;
	text-decoration:none;
	font-weight:bold;
}

#content a:hover {
	text-decoration:none;
	color:#000;
	font-weight:bold;
}

#content a:visited {
	text-decoration:none;
	color:#999;
	font-weight:bold;
}

/*--- Bottom Nav ---*/

#navBottom {
	position:relative;
	margin-top:0px;
	width:850px;
	text-align:center;
	color:#999;
	font-size:9px;
}

#navBottom >a:link, #navBottom >a:visited{
	text-decoration:none;
	color:#999;
	padding-right:20px;
	padding-left:20px;
}

#navBottom >a:hover {
	text-decoration:none;
	color:#666;
}

/*--- Waiting Page ----*/

#headerW {
	background:url(images/waitingImg/top.jpg) no-repeat;
	width:850px;
	height:127px;
	position:relative;
}

#navBarW {
	background:url(images/waitingImg/bar.jpg);
	width:850px;
	height:30px;
	position:relative;
}

#waitingContent {
	background:url(images/waitingImg/bottom.jpg) no-repeat;
	width:850px;
	height:337px;
	position:relative;
}

#process {
	position:absolute;
	color:#67ba91;
	width:300px;
	margin:30px 0px 0px 404px;
}

#thisPros {
	position:absolute;
	color:#67ba91;
	margin:65px 0px 0px 415px;
}

#waitBar {
	background:url(images/waitingImg/00.jpg) no-repeat;
	width:480px;
	height:24px;
	position:absolute;
	margin:90px 0px 0px 300px;
}

#please {
	position:absolute;
	color:#67ba91;
	margin:300px 0px 0px 410px;
}

#waitGif 
{
	position:absolute;
	margin:150px 0px 0px 500px;	
}

/********************************************************************************
***                           Application page                                ***
*********************************************************************************/

.masterTable
{
	width:100%;
	border-bottom-style:ridge;
	border-bottom-width:medium;
}

.leftBox
{
	 width:30%;
	 text-align:left;
	 background-color:#9AD1BD;
	 border-right-style:solid;
	 border-right-width:thin;
	 border-right-color:#CCC;
	 padding-left:15px;
	 padding-right:10px;
}

.rightBox
{
	width:70%;
	background-color:White;
	margin-left:10px;
}

.shortName
{
	width:75px;
}

.longName
{
	width:150px;
}

.Header
{
	font-size:larger;
	font-weight:bold;
	color:#67BA91;
}

.TermsOfUse
{
	 color:Gray;
	 font-size:13px;
	 background-color:White;
	 padding:5px;
}

.LightText
{
	color:#698FDA;
}

.LightText2
{
	color:#65A3FF;/*E0*/
}

.DarkText
{
	color:#323498;
}


